The Roman Catholic Archdiocese of Jinan {Latin: Zinanen(sis), 中文: 濟南} is an archdiocese located in the city of Jinan in China.

History

  • September 3, 1839: Established as Apostolic Vicariate of Shantung from the Diocese of Beijing
  • December 2, 1885: Renamed as Apostolic Vicariate of Northern Shantung
  • December 3, 1924: Renamed as Apostolic Vicariate of Tsinanfu
  • April 11, 1946: Promoted as Metropolitan Archdiocese of Jinan
